Expedited Funds Availability Act (EFAA)

Law enacted by Congress in 1987 to regulate holding periods for checking accounts. The Act stipulates the number of days that funds from a check deposit can be withheld from being transferred or withdrawn. The period varies depending on the check amount and the location of the originating bank. Also called Regulation CC.
